35: /* Stack of pending (incomplete) sequences saved by `start_sequence'.
36: Each element describes one pending sequence.
37: The main insn-chain is saved in the last element of the chain,
38: unless the chain is empty. */
39:
40: struct sequence_stack
41: {
42: /* First and last insns in the chain of the saved sequence. */
43: rtx first, last;
44: struct sequence_stack *next;
45: };
46:
47: extern struct sequence_stack *sequence_stack;

162: /* The FUNCTION_DECL for an inline function currently being expanded. */
163: extern tree inline_function_decl;
164:
165: /* Label that will go on function epilogue.
166: Jumping to this label serves as a "return" instruction
167: on machines which require execution of the epilogue on all returns. */
168: extern rtx return_label;
169:
170: /* List (chain of EXPR_LISTs) of all stack slots in this function.
171: Made for the sake of unshare_all_rtl. */
172: extern rtx stack_slot_list;
